Walter White works for Dodgy insurance company. Walter is given the task of predicting how many houses in a rural suburb in Victoria will be destroyed by a ?re in the next 12 months out of a sample of 3000 randomly chosen houses and assessing the degree of loss related to insuring these houses.

Part A.

Identify two factors that would increase the degree of risk and two factors that would decrease the degree of risk in the above scenario.

Part B.

Based on Walter's evaluation, assume that the insurance company has decided to accept the above risk. Should the insurance company insure more houses in the area? Why or why not?
